#3dfc00 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3dfc00 is composed of 23.9% red, 98.8% green and 0%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 75.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 100% yellow and 1.2% black. It has a hue angle of 105.5 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 49.4%. #3dfc00 color hex could be obtained by blending #7aff00 with #00f900. Closest websafe color is: #33ff00.

#3dfc00 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3dfc00 has RGB values of R:61, G:252, B:0 and CMYK values of C:0.76, M:0, Y:1, K:0.01. Its decimal value is 4062208.

Shades and Tints of #3dfc00
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#041100 is the darkest color, while #fdfffc is the lightest one.

Tones of #3dfc00
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#798874 is the less saturated color, while #3dfc00 is the most saturated one.
